George Washington University Law School: October 1.<br /><br />For assistance in planning your applications to top law schools, please see my website, <a href="http://www.PrelawAdvisor.com">www.PrelawAdvisor.com</a>, or send an e-mail to BradDobeck@aol.com .Brad Dobeckh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/03805802383924374918no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-30202689.post-20710107185065678492008-09-12T09:20:00.000-05:002008-09-12T09:21:02.997-05:00How do I transfer to a better, higher-tier law school?The law school transfer application process works most effectively in the following scenario.<br /><br />An applicant applies to a top law school, with a strong file, a strong GPA, but with a relatively low LSAT. Because of the top school's LSAT sensitivity, the applicant is rejected, but reluctantly.<br /><br />The applicant is admitted to a lower-tier school. The applicant, now a 1L law student at the lower-tier school, works very effectively, earning top grades. At the end of year one, when the grades come out, this student is easily within the top 5% of her 1L class. Maybe she's even number one or number two in her 1L class. She has cultivated an excellent relationship with three professors--over the whole year--never once mentioning a transfer desire. Now, with top grades undeniably earned, she asks for their help as recommenders on a transfer application to the higher-tier law school. They reluctantly agree, not wanting to lose a top student, but certainly understanding her desire, and recognizing that their law school does benefit to some degree if a few of their top students can win a transfer to a higher-tier law school. These professors regard her as one of the best students they've ever had. They say so, in writing. She writes a brilliant personal statement, which has zero whining. She employs the principles advocated by PrelawAdvisor.com. She launches this carefully crafted application, early in the target school's transfer cycle (late spring, early summer).<br /><br />Because the LSAT scores and college GPAs of transfer students are not publicly measured (like enrolling 1Ls are in the US News & World Report), these don't play any great role. A check back at her original application reveals that she previously had a deal-making application--except for her LSAT score. But her brilliant performance at the lower-tier school in her 1L year convinces them that she really has tier-one talent. She is admitted.<br /><br />So, what you have to do is build a brilliant first year, and then "market" it to thoughtfully and realistically chosen target schools. What should I do now?<p> </p><span style="font-weight: bold; font-family: times new roman;"></span> <p class="MsoNormal" style="margin-bottom: 12pt;"><b>The bad news:</b> You <i style="">certainly</i> aren't ready for real LSAT. Do not apply to law school...yet. The law schools regard the LSAT as more or less the IQ test for law school. At a practice score of say, 138, you are at a point where over 90% of official LSAT results are above you. Law schools will have the gravest concerns about your abilities, if you give them this score officially.<br /><br /><b>The good news: </b> The LSAT <i style="">can</i> be mastered. If you are below 140, you are currently extremely low on the LSAT learning curve. But you <i style="">can</i> move forward.<br /><br />Let me share the most positive story of LSAT mastery I've come across over the years.<span style=""> </span>Note that this path was inexpensive.<span style=""> </span>It did not require high-priced LSAT tutoring or courses.<span style=""> </span>But it did require a considerable amount of time, in a disciplined and effective program of self-development.<o:p></o:p></p> <p class="MsoNormal"><em>"It took me about half a year to prepare for the test since I was still in school and had other exams to cope with. What I did was really simple! I took a test under simulated conditions on Monday. On Tuesday, I went over the test again, problem by problem, and analyzed the answers and marked the questions I didn't really understand well, without any time restraint. On Wednesday, I took a break. Thursdays through Saturdays I repeated my Monday through Wednesday schedule. On Sunday, I restudied the difficult questions in the two sets I took in that week. The entire process took me 17 weeks. I took two weeks off to deal with school exams. In total it took me 19 weeks. At first glance, you may think I spent a great deal of time preparing for the LSAT. I took 34 practice tests! But counting the hours, it's not that much. I believe I spent an average of six hours on each test, including two review sessions. That adds up to around 200 hours in total. My score improved from 151 on the first test </em><em><b style=""><span style="font-style: normal;">(a 49<sup>th</sup>-percentile score that would definitely not be attractive to top law schools)</span></b> to low/mid 170s on the last five tests. My actual test score was 177.” </em><em><b style=""><span style="font-style: normal;">(This is a stunning 99.8<sup>th</sup>-percentile score that will cause law school admissions officials to fall out of their chairs).</span></b></em><i><br /><br />“<em>My improvement from the low 150s to the low 160s was quick, about seven to eight tests. But it took me 15-20 tests to go from 160 to 170. Once I broke 170, I stayed in the low to mid 170s for the remaining seven to nine tests. It seems to me that about three weeks and six to eight tests are needed to consolidate a level. That's why I think it's important to take as many real tests as possible (at least 25, 30+ is preferred).”</em><br /><br />“<em>I graduated from a college in northeast and am going to law school in the same region next semester."</em><o:p></o:p></i></p> <p class="MsoNormal"><i> <o:p></o:p></i></p> <p class="MsoNormal"><em><span style="font-style: normal;">He was admitted to <st1:place st="on"><st1:placename st="on">Harvard</st1:placename> <st1:placename st="on">Law</st1:placename> <st1:placetype st="on">School</st1:placetype></st1:place> with his 177.<o:p></o:p></span></em></p> <p class="MsoNormal"><em><o:p> </o:p></em></p> If you are struggling with a low LSAT score in practice, you will benefit by having a comprehensive plan developed for you by me at <a href="http://www.prelawadvisor.com/">PrelawAdvisor.com</a>.<span style=""> </span>Don’t act solely on your own assumptions about how the law school admissions process will work.<span style=""> </span>Don’t trust the law schools to lift you to your goal.<span style=""> </span>Law schools are better understood as simply creating an obstacle course for you to conquer and solve effectively.<span style=""> </span>Send an e-mail to BradDobeck@aol.com<span style="text-decoration: underline;"></span>, and we can go to work together, building a solid, multi-year plan for your career progress.Brad Dobeckh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/03805802383924374918no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-30202689.post-23059093178204921992008-09-11T17:46:00.000-05:002008-09-11T17:47:34.501-05:00I've earned an official 170+ LSAT score. How do I best take advantage of it?<p> </p>Congratulations! You've really got the "right stuff," in the minds of law school admissions decision makers. They are going to be <span style="font-style: italic;">extremely interested</span> in you. But be aware that you need to protect your interests carefully. Given your high LSAT score, law schools will be eager to present you with opportunities that benefit <span style="font-style: italic;">their</span> interests. You need an advocate and advisor who will help you make the most of such a high LSAT score, someone who will put <span style="font-style: italic;">your</span> interests first.<br /><br />Recognize these points:<br /><br />1. Understand <span style="font-style: italic;">why</span> the law schools are so strongly attracted to persons with high official LSAT scores. The <span style="font-style: italic;">US News & World Report</span> ranking phenomenon creates enormous incentives for law schools to seek high-LSAT students. If they can attract them, their numbers go up, and in time they can move up in the rankings. The <span style="font-style: italic;">USN&WR</span> ranking system is enormously influential. Love schools <span style="font-style: italic;">love</span> to have bragging rights to enrolling students with high LSAT scores. The law school admission process is a competition for cognitive talent.<br /><br />2. Don't rely on a high LSAT alone to carry you into an elite, top 10 or top 5 law school. You need to present the whole package, to the maximum extent possible: a great GPA, a strong undergraduate school (or at least a highly respected path through a lesser undergraduate school), a brilliant personal statement, the right timing, and strongly supportive recommendations from properly selected and prepared recommenders. Look to <a href="http://www.prelawadvisor.com/">PrelawAdvisor.com</a> to assist you in hitting this "sweet spot."<br /><br />3. Include in your strategy a plan to win some law school admission offers that include a full-tuition scholarship. You might not end up taking it, but at least work carefully to create such an option. You can save yourself and your family thousands and thousands of dollars this way. But you have to craft your message just right. I can help you do this. I've actually seen a law school make this offer to get a highly attractive candidate: (1) A full-tuition scholarship for all three years; (2) free room and board; (3) free books; (4) a $1,000 month stipend; and (5) a no-cost LL.M degree (the advanced law degree one can choose to earn after earning a JD degree). What do I do now?<p> </p>The short answer, one that eventually will greatly distinguish you down the road, is....<span style="font-style: italic;">get great grades</span>. <span style="font-style: italic;">Get great grades</span>. The common pattern of GPAs of college students seeking law school admission in the future, is a bumpy first year, with relatively lower grades, followed by progressively improving grades in the second, third and fourth years of college. But it is clearly those applicants with the very highest GPAs (meaning high grades during the <span style="font-style: italic;">freshman year</span>, as well as the rest of their college years) who break into the top ten--especially the top five--elite law schools. If Yale, Stanford and Harvard have law schools with enrolling student classes in the 3.8 GPA range, you can't afford too many grades lower than an "A".<br /><br />So, if you want to be the most effective future competitor for a spot at an elite law school, stay focused now, in your freshman year, on all your courses. Do what gets measured. Attend all your classes. Get to know your professors. Do all your reading. Contribute positively to class discussions. Prepare thoroughly for each exam. Seek to discover what your professors' old exams are like. Perhaps they are on file at your school in a way that is accessible to you, such as at your school's library.<br /><br />In addition, move forward in other ways. Engage your college's community in a creative way. Get involved in activities and projects of interest to you, especially if they can be law-related. Some examples: offer volunteer service to a local legal aid clinic. Just walk in, introduce yourself, and use the magic "<span style="font-style: italic;">v</span>" word: "I'm a new college freshman at (name your school) and I want to <span style="font-style: italic;">volunteer</span> some time to your organization." The doors will spring open. You may be doing low-level clerical work at first, but stay with it, and you will climb the learning curve, and begin to learn the work of the lawyers there. Make yourself indispensable there, with the time you have to give.<br /><br />Or pick a political or social cause of interest to you, on campus or in the surrounding community. What are you passionate about? What changes would you like to see made to society? What are the organization's lawyers doing? How does the current state of the law affect things? Join in and help out. What should I do?<p> </p>I frequently deal with law school advisees who have had a brush with the law in their past. It might have been underage drinking, with the use of a false ID card. It might have been a speeding ticket, or one for violation of some other motor vehicle law, such as curfew violation or failure to use a seatbelt. It could have been a noise violation in your college setting.<br /><br />Here's how to handle the issue of disclosing a criminal record in a law school application.<br /><br />1. <span style="font-style: italic;">Don't hide anything. Make a full disclosure.</span> Answer the law school's question fully and with complete honesty. Some law schools require the disclosure of matters officially expunged from the criminal record. Disclose them. I actually recommend that you disclose <span style="font-style: italic;">all</span> matters, including expunged convictions.<br /><br />2. <span style="font-style: italic;">"Fall on your sword."</span> In other words, "Admit your mistake(s) emphatically." What was wrong is wrong. Don't try to justify bad behavior or let yourself off the hook. Don't make the argument that "Everybody was doing it." Convince them now that you would <span style="font-style: italic;">never</span> engage in such behavior again.<br /><br />3. Remember that you will have to make a full disclosure as well--down the road--to the <span style="font-style: italic;">state bar</span> of the state where you will want to practice law. State bars may look back to your law school application to see what you said about your criminal record. It had better be a full, complete and entirely honest disclosure, conforming precisely to the disclosure you make on your bar exam, or--frankly--you may not be admitted to the bar. First, let's think about physical location. Do you envision going to law school in an urban, suburban or rural setting?<br /><br />2. Do you want to remain in such a setting after law school is over for you?<br /><br />3. Do you think you want a national, regional, or local law school? National law schools are the toughest in terms of admission challenge, but offer the greatest access to the national job market. However, they are likely to be the most expensive. Regional law schools, often public, can be quite respected in their region or state, and can be less expensive than private law schools, but they often lack a national reach in terms of the job market. Local law schools are the easiest challenge in terms of admission, but typically receive only limited interest from legal employers beyond the local market. And private local law schools can be very expensive.<br /><br />4. Consider the reach of the school in the job market. Begin to get a sense of who recruits there by checking the <a href="http://www.nalpdirectory.com/">NALP Directory</a>.<br /><br />5. Do you want a law school that is cooperative in its culture? Or competitive?<br /><br />6. How harsh or friendly is the school's grading policy? Does the school provide class ranking data? Or does it refrain from doing so? An excellent source of information on these issues is The <a href="http://www.bcgsearch.com/pdf/BCG_Law_Schoool_Guide_2008.pdf">2008 BCG Attorney Search Guide to America’s Top 50 Law Schools</a>.<br /><br />7. How diverse is the student body there? Are you going to feel comfortable there, and part of the community?<br /><br />8. What about the political character of the professors and students? Does the law school have what you are looking for?<br /><br />9. Does the law school have a religious affiliation that you might want?<br /><br />10. What about the law school's cost? Do students really pay the stated tuition cost, or do many receive discounts through aid, grants and scholarships?<br /><br />11. Does the area surrounding the law school offer you some of the things that you want for recreation, personal growth, fun, learning, meeting people, jobs, and institutions that matter to you?<br /><br />12. As you visit a potential school's website--or better the actual physical setting of a potential law school--what is your reaction to their facilities? Are they new, or old? How comfortable are the students? Is there convenient internet access for everyone? Adequate library and study space? What about parking? Public transportation? And what about personal safety, in the school and neighborhood?<br /><br />13. If you are physically there, stroll into a public bathroom for a quick look. This might sound odd to you, but it can reveal something important about the culture of the school. Are the bathrooms dirty or clean? Supplied adequately, or missing important things? Are the bathrooms covered with angry student graffiti, or are the walls and stalls clean?<br /><br />14. Consider the average age and life experience of students at this law school. Are they mostly fresh from college, or do they have some work experience?
